About Iscove's Modified Dulbecco's Medium, with L-Glutamine, without Supplements
Iscove's Modified Dulbecco's Medium (IMDM) is a complex and enriched growth medium for cell culture. It is a modification of Dulbecco's Modified Eagle Medium (DMEM) and contains selenium as well as additional amino acids and vitamins. IMDM medium is usually supplemented with Fetal Bovine Serum (FBS) and is used for the cultivation of specialized cell types, such as Jurkat, COS-7, and macrophage cells. This formulation of IMDM comes with L-Glutamine.
